Sažetak
The uptake of zinc, copper, and lead from aqueous solutions of different initial concentrations on natural zeolitic tuff has been studied. The amount of exchangeable cations Na, K, Ca, and Mg in filtrates after equilibration indicates a nonstoichiometry in ion exchange process, due to the detachment of the aluminosilicate structure in the presence of H^+ and OH^- ions. The proposed adsorption isotherm equations, derived from basic empirical equations, aim to approach the adsorption model that fits the experimental results best.
